What is Somatic Experiencing?
Somatic Experiencing is a therapeutic technique developed by Dr. Peter A. Levine that focuses on the body's physical sensations to help release stored traumatic experiences. This approach recognizes that trauma is not just psychological but also manifests in the body's physical responses.

How does it work?
During a Somatic Experiencing session, a trained practitioner helps individuals tune into their body's sensations and responses. By gradually guiding clients to explore and release tension held in the body, the process aims to regulate the nervous system and promote healing.
Benefits of Somatic Experiencing:
- Reduces symptoms of stress and anxiety
- Improves emotional regulation
- Enhances resilience to future stressors
- Supports overall well-being and vitality
Practices to Cultivate Mind-Body Connection:
Aside from Somatic Experiencing, there are various practices you can incorporate into your daily routine to enhance the mind-body connection:
- Yoga: Combining movement with breath, yoga helps to center the mind and release physical tension.
- Mindfulness Meditation: By focusing on the present moment, mindfulness meditation can calm the mind and reduce stress.
- Deep Breathing Exercises: Taking deep, intentional breaths can signal the body to relax and unwind.
- Body Scan: Regularly scanning your body for areas of tension and consciously relaxing them can promote a sense of well-being.
